FAQs
What is the salary range for the Store Manager position?
The salary for the Store Manager position ranges from £29,000 to £32,000 per annum, depending on the size of the store.
What are the main responsibilities of a Store Manager at Costa Coffee?
The main responsibilities include creating a welcoming space for customers, managing stock and controllable costs, inspiring and training your team, and maximizing sales opportunities.
Is prior leadership experience required for this position?
Yes, leadership experience is required as the role involves managing and developing team members.
What benefits do Store Managers receive?
Store Managers receive a salary, a quarterly bonus scheme, free handmade drinks while on shift, a 50% discount on food and drinks, bespoke training and development programs, and various other perks.
